Optical Network Architecture Supporting Dynamic and End-to-End Quantum Secure Networking

R. Nejabati, R. Wang, G. T. Kanellos and D. Simeonidou, “Optical Network Architecture Supporting Dynamic and End-to-End Quantum Secure Networking,” 2021 European Conference on Optical Communication (ECOC), 2021, pp. 1-4, doi: 10.1109/ECOC52684.2021.9606129.

This paper proposes an optical network architecture including physical layer and control plane supporting dynamic networking and co-existence of quantum and classical channels over the same fibre infrastructure. It will discuss technological challenges for realising the proposed architecture and potential solutions for addressing them.
